ASP教程:精通Cookie读写技巧与实施策略
| 
                         ASP(Active Server Pages)是一种用于创建动态网页的技术,而Cookie是ASP中常用的客户端存储机制。通过Cookie,服务器可以在用户的浏览器上保存一些信息,以便后续请求时使用。 在ASP中读取Cookie非常简单,可以通过Request.Cookies集合来访问。例如,如果有一个名为“user”的Cookie,可以使用Request.Cookies(\"user\")来获取其值。需要注意的是,如果Cookie不存在,该操作会返回一个空的值,因此在使用前应进行判断。 写入Cookie需要使用Response.Cookies对象。设置Cookie的值后,还需要指定过期时间,否则Cookie会在浏览器关闭时自动删除。例如,可以使用Response.Cookies(\"user\") = \"John\",然后设置Response.Cookies(\"user\").Expires = Now() + 1,表示Cookie将在一天后过期。 Cookie的路径和域设置也很重要。默认情况下,Cookie只对当前页面所在的目录有效。如果希望Cookie在网站的其他页面中可用,可以使用Response.Cookies(\"user\").Path = \"/\"来设置路径。同样,通过设置Domain属性,可以控制Cookie在哪些子域名中生效。 
 AI设计效果图,仅供参考 安全性方面,应避免在Cookie中存储敏感信息,如密码或用户凭证。可以设置HttpOnly标志,防止JavaScript访问Cookie,从而降低跨站脚本攻击的风险。 实际应用中,合理使用Cookie可以提升用户体验,例如记住用户偏好设置或实现自动登录功能。但同时也需注意隐私政策和数据保护法规,确保符合相关法律法规。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!  | 
                  

